The UniMark Group, Inc. (OTC Bulletin Board: UNMG) announced yesterday that has sold 7,106,502 shares of its common stock at $ .73 per share to its existing shareholders, with gross proceeds to the Company of $5.2 million. The Company’s largest shareholder, M & M Nominee, LLC., purchased 6,849,315 shares in the offering. As a result of the offering, UniMark’s outstanding shares of common stock has increased to 21,044,828 shares. The Company further announced that its shareholders have approved an amendment to its articles of incorporation that increased the authorized number of shares of common stock from 20,000,000 shares to 40,000,000 shares, approved the rights offering and re-elected the Company’s current board of directors.

About The UniMark Group, Inc.

The UniMark Group, Inc. is a vertically integrated citrus and tropical fruit growing and processing company supplying major branded food companies in the United States and selected countries worldwide, with substantially all of its operations in Mexico.
